Born in 1924, he grew up at 130 East Passaic Avenue, Rutherford. He attended Mt. Ararat Church, boxed, played football, and dreamed of flying. At Rutherford High, he completed a three-year college equivalency to join the Army Air Corps. He served in the 100th Fighter Squadron, 332nd Fighter Group, the "Red Tail" pilots led by Benjamin O. Davis Jr. He flew 26 combat missions and was honorably discharged.
